Ruitai Mining Company, a Chinese mining operation based in the Esuk Ikim Akeme community, Ibeno Local Government Area of Akwa Ibom State, was reportedly shut down by the state government due to unlawful mining of Titanium Ore.
On Tuesday, Uno Etim Uno, the Commissioner for Environment and Mineral Resources, hosted members of the reporters chapel in his office in Uyo, where he made the announcement.
He said that during an assessment of the Ruitai Mining site he and Brigadier General Koko Essien (rtd), Commissioner of the Ministry of Internal Security, found evidence of unlawful mining.

He said the black clay-like mineral was found in 50-kilogram sacks, but the company’s managing director and director, Zeng Zhonghuan and Huang Ying, weren’t there and the on-site staff didn’t have any paperwork to prove they had permission to operate.
He said that the government had asked the police and the ARMY to take control of the site when the discovery was made, and that Ruitai had been given until this Friday to submit paperwork authorising the firm to mine the mineral.
